Remember: you are renting *from the owner*, not *from Wyndham*. So, what this really means is that your rental is fully non-refundable. So you would be well-served to get trip-insurance if there is a genuine possibility you will not be able to go. Shop carefully, because some policies have windows in which you have to buy, else some pre-existing conditions will not be covered.
